1. Last Day of School Sign

Frame your FREE Last Day of School printable sign and dress up for a "porchtrait." We added a pop of color with Crayola's silky smooth Gel Crayons.



2. DIY Yard Letters

Make your own oversized yard letters with foam poster board and BBQ skewers. We brought out the wow factor with Crayola's XL Poster Markers. These markers are so big that we got more coverage faster than the average marker.


3. School Year Folder

Get your school work organized with a decorated file folder. We added some glitz and glam with Crayola's Glitter Markers. No more drab file folders in our house!



4. Confetti Cannon

Create a confetti cannon with an empty paper tube, a balloon, tape, and paper. We added some shine with Crayola's Metallic Outline Markers. The way the color appears around the metallic lines is like magic before your eyes. We've never seen a product quite like this before!



5. Learning Rocks

Show off what you've learned over the year by painting rocks with sight words, spelling words, and vocabulary words. Crayola's paints are so vibrant! Since our rocks will find a home outside, we sealed the paintings to keep them bright and colorful even longer.
